+ void ServiceContextMongoD::setGlobalStorageEngine(const std::string& name) {
+ // This should be set once.
+ invariant(!_storageEngine);
+
+ const StorageEngine::Factory* factory = _storageFactories[name];
+
+ uassert(18656, str::stream()
+ << "Cannot start server with an unknown storage engine: " << name,
+ factory);
+
+ std::string canonicalName = factory->getCanonicalName().toString();
+
+ // Do not proceed if data directory has been used by a different storage engine previously.
+ std::auto_ptr<StorageEngineMetadata> metadata =
+ StorageEngineMetadata::validate(storageGlobalParams.dbpath, canonicalName);
+
+ // Validate options in metadata against current startup options.
+ if (metadata.get()) {
+ uassertStatusOK(factory->validateMetadata(*metadata, storageGlobalParams));
+ }
+
+ try {
+ _lockFile.reset(new StorageEngineLockFile(storageGlobalParams.dbpath));
+ }
+ catch (const std::exception& ex) {
+ uassert(28596, str::stream()
+ << "Unable to determine status of lock file in the data directory "
+ << storageGlobalParams.dbpath << ": " << ex.what(),
+ false);
+ }
+ if (_lockFile->createdByUncleanShutdown()) {
+ warning() << "Detected unclean shutdown - "
+ << _lockFile->getFilespec() << " is not empty.";
+ }
+ uassertStatusOK(_lockFile->open());
+
+ ScopeGuard guard = MakeGuard(&StorageEngineLockFile::close, _lockFile.get());
+ _storageEngine = factory->create(storageGlobalParams, *_lockFile);
+ _storageEngine->finishInit();
+ uassertStatusOK(_lockFile->writePid());
+
+ // Write a new metadata file if it is not present.
+ if (!metadata.get()) {
+ metadata.reset(new StorageEngineMetadata(storageGlobalParams.dbpath));
+ metadata->setStorageEngine(canonicalName);
+ metadata->setStorageEngineOptions(factory->createMetadataOptions(storageGlobalParams));
+ uassertStatusOK(metadata->write());
+ }
+
+ guard.Dismiss();
+
+ _supportsDocLocking = _storageEngine->supportsDocLocking();
+ }
